Go to Tools->Plugins in pidgin and disable or customize "Libnotify Popups" plugin.

Also, you can customize these notifications (e.g. ignore some of them, change their urgency level, etc.) via dunst settings. It seems that you're using this notification daemon.

For more info, see 'man dunst' and the example dunst configuration file. It should be available in /usr/share/dunst/dunstrc.
